blob: 2a9bffb3efc2343204f1b48d962b705c9713ba25 [file] [log] [blame]
Chungying Lua566cc92023-03-15 14:16:28 +08001/*
2 * Copyright (c) 2023, MediaTek Inc. All rights reserved.
3 *
4 * SPDX-License-Identifier: BSD-3-Clause
5 */
6
7#ifndef APUSYS_H
8#define APUSYS_H
9
10#define MODULE_TAG "[APUSYS]"
11
Chungying Luf1f14b32023-03-15 15:31:56 +080012enum MTK_APUSYS_KERNEL_OP {
Chungying Lu15ffb072023-04-19 17:17:23 +080013 MTK_APUSYS_KERNEL_OP_APUSYS_PWR_TOP_ON, /* 0 */
14 MTK_APUSYS_KERNEL_OP_APUSYS_PWR_TOP_OFF, /* 1 */
15 MTK_APUSYS_KERNEL_OP_APUSYS_RV_SETUP_REVISER, /* 2 */
16 MTK_APUSYS_KERNEL_OP_APUSYS_RV_RESET_MP, /* 3 */
17 MTK_APUSYS_KERNEL_OP_APUSYS_RV_SETUP_BOOT, /* 4 */
18 MTK_APUSYS_KERNEL_OP_APUSYS_RV_START_MP, /* 5 */
19 MTK_APUSYS_KERNEL_OP_APUSYS_RV_STOP_MP, /* 6 */
Karl Li03facb02023-04-24 16:45:49 +080020 MTK_APUSYS_KERNEL_OP_DEVAPC_INIT_RCX, /* 7 */
Chungying Luf1f14b32023-03-15 15:31:56 +080021 MTK_APUSYS_KERNEL_OP_NUM,
22};
23
Chungying Lua566cc92023-03-15 14:16:28 +080024#endif